🎟️ How to Set Up and Sell Raffle Tickets
Raffles are a fun and effective way to raise additional funds at your event. ClickBid gives you several ways to sell raffle tickets depending on how your event is structured.
⚠️ Raffle laws vary by state. Always check your local and state regulations before selling raffle tickets at your event.
🧾 Step 1: Create Your Raffle Item
- Go to Items > Manage Items.
- Click Add Item.
- Enter the item name, description, and category.
- Set the Item Type to Quantity.
- Set the Fair Market Value (FMV) to match the single ticket price.
- Under Set Quantity/Purchase Price Options, click Quantity for Price to add your ticket pricing tiers. For example: 1 for $50, 3 for $100, 5 for $150.
ℹ️ If you offer multiple pricing tiers, the FMV will default to the price of the first tier entered. Make sure that first tier reflects the per-ticket value.
💡 Raffle ticket purchases are not tax-deductible per IRS guidelines. Always set the FMV equal to the ticket price so the software does not display a deductible amount on receipts.

🛍️ Step 2: Choose a Way to Sell Raffle Tickets
You have three options depending on your event type and goals
🧑💻 Option A: Sell In-Person via the Butler
Best for in-person events where volunteers or staff are selling tickets at the event.
- Go to Items > Manage Items and set your raffle item's Status to Invisible so guests cannot purchase it online.
- Launch the Butler from Event Central > Butler, or share the volunteer link from Software Settings > Auction Settings > Butler Settings.
- Volunteers log into Butler, search for the bidder, and use Add a Bid / Multi-Sale or Multi-Sale - Quick Entry to sell tickets.
- The purchase is added to the bidders cart for checkout later.
💳 To Add a Purchase and Check Out at the Same Time
If you want to sell a raffle ticket and collect payment in the same step:
- In the Butler, go to Bidder Lookup and enter the bidder's last name.
- Locate the bidder in the results.
- to the far right of the results click Select an Action, then choose Quick Buy.
- Enter the quantity being purchased and click Continue.
- Review the order and click Confirm.
- You will be redirected to the checkout page where you select the payment type and complete the transaction.
ℹ️Quantity items can be sold through the Butler even after the item's closing time has passed.

To Mark a Raffle as Sold Out
- Go to Items > Manage Items and click the edit icon next to your raffle item.
- Set Limited? to Quantity.
- Set Quantity Remaining to 0.


🌐 Option B: Sell Online
Best for virtual or hybrid events where guests purchase tickets from their own devices.
- Go to Items > Manage Items.
- Set your raffle item's Status to Active.
- Guests can now purchase tickets directly from the bidding site on their phones or computers.
🎫 Option C: Sell via the Ticket Page (Quantity Items)
Best when you want raffle tickets to appear alongside event registration on your ticket page.
- Go to Items > Manage Items and confirm your raffle item is set up as a Quantity type item.
- Go to Event Tickets > Ticket Page Settings.
- Expand the Additional Features section.
- Find the Quantity Items field and select your raffle item from the list. Use Ctrl-click to select multiple items.
- Save your settings.
The raffle item will now appear as a purchasable option on your ticket page.
🎫 Option D: Sell via Underwriting on the Ticket Page
Best for bundling raffle tickets with event registration as an add-on purchase.
- Go to Event Tickets > Modify Tickets.
- Click Add Underwriting.
- Fill in the following fields:
- Name: enter your raffle ticket name
- Price: set the per-entry cost
- Fair Market Value: match it to the price
- Description: add a short description of the raffle
- Availability: set a ticket limit, or 0 for unlimited
- Hide Availability: choose Yes if you want to hide how many tickets remain
⚠️ The FMV must match the Raffle ticket price. A mismatch could indicate a tax-deductible amount, which is not accurate for raffle tickets.
To View Underwriting Sales
- Go to Event Tickets > View Ticket Sales.
- Toggle Show All at the top left.
- Click the arrow next to Underwriting to bring all Underwriting sales to the top and in a row.
- Click the CSV button to download the full sales report.
🏆 Step 3: Pull Raffle Entry Data and Choose a Winner
This process works for tickets sold via Butler, online, or through Quantity Items on the ticket page. It does not apply to Underwriting sales.
- Go to Items > Manage Items.
- Click the Has Bids tag next to your raffle item to filter by purchasers.
- Click Download Qty Purchases to export a spreadsheet.
- Each row in the spreadsheet represents one raffle entry. Bidders who purchased multiple tickets will appear on multiple rows.
- Use a random number generator, such as Google’s Random Number Generator, to pick a winning row number.
- Match the winning number to the corresponding entry in the spreadsheet.
⚠️ If you are running multiple raffles, repeat this process separately for each item.

📊 Step 4: View Raffle Sales Reports
Find raffle ticket sales in the following reports:
- Reports > Sales Data: Quantity Sales Data
- Reports > Non Silent Items
- Reports > Event Sales
- Reports > Post Event Data
💡Use these reports for reconciling sales or preparing for prize distribution.
